Where do they find these guys? 14,865 yards passing/ 125 TDs/ 26 Ints./ 63.1 completion % /1060 rushing yards/ 26 ranking TDs/ 2023 All B12 QB, not playoff QB Quinn Ewers at Texas.

 

It may have been a long journey for Dillon but he is hardly a 'journeyman.' 

Ultimately, [Oregon is getting] consummate consistency. He’s hungry, he’s driven. He’s willing to put the work in. He improves from whatever areas, he attacks his weaknesses and plays within his strengths and he’s a great teammate.”

 

    - Venables said during the 2024 SEC Spring Meetings in Destin, FL.

Gabriel on Lanning:

 

Said that Lanning’s coaching style is “innovative” and “refreshing”

 

“Lanning is active in practices whether it’s running, lifting — “He’s sweating at practice, he’s in it,” Gabriel said. “I feel like that is an empowering feeling knowing that your coach is being a part of what you’re doing, not having levels of a hierarchy.””
